JJ trotted quickly through the BAU office. She was nervously checking around to ensure things were in top shape. Her sunshine yellow mane was swept to the side off her face ensure she looked professional and capable.
JJ usually didn’t get so up in a twist over guest to the office. But royalty didn’t usually come calling either.
Hotch assembled the rest of the team in the conference room. As per JJ’s request, allowing the media liaison time to confer with the princesses.
Reid, Morgan and Prentiss all stood sneakily peaking through the blinds at the bull pen. All three were taken by awe as two regal alicorns swept in.
JJ bowed deeply, “Princess Celestia, Princess Luna.”
“Agent Jareau.” Celestia greeted kindly, “I wish we came with better tidings but, we have a very important case for your team.”
“Of course Princess. Shall I take down the details and talk to the team?”
“No,” Luna said glancing towards the conference room. She had to fight very hard to keep a small smile off her face at the three pairs of curious eyes watching her and her elder sister through the shutters, “its better we inform them directly.”
“As you wish your majesties.” JJ spoke nervously, “If you would follow me.”

Celestia conjured a picture of a young Pegasus, with a pale blue coat and a tomboy-ish-ly cut rainbow streaked mane.
“This is Rainbow Dash.” The daylight princess explained to the profilers, “Chief weather Pegasus of Ponyville.”
Morgan leaned forward to closer study the picture, “She was the winner of the Best Young Flier competition in Cloudsdayle last year. She flew so fast she achieved a Sonic Rainboom.”
“That’s Dash.” Celestia allowed a bit of pride to enter her voice. Then her expression fell, “Rainbow has been missing for 2 days now. There’s no trace of her anywhere.” The elder princess’s voice began to choke up so Luna took over the briefing.
“Dash isn’t the first to disappear either. Only a few days before Dash’s disappearance a little filly from the local school went missing. Twist. She’s just a child, only had her cutie mark for a month.” Luna looked sadly at the screen as the image of a bright happy young filly filled it.
“We’ve also received a report that a young griffon who’d been visiting Ponyville never made it home. Her name is Gilda.” Princess Celestia had gathered herself again, “As well as a few dozen other ponies in and around Ponyville to just up and disappear.”
“We want you,” Luna addressed everypony with a quick look, “to go to Ponyville and investigate.”
“Any local law enforcement to work with?” Rossi asked.
“No official police force, but my apprentice, Twilight Sparkle, is more than willing to help you. She’s very intelligent, dedicated to her studies, and has agreed to grant you access to the Ponyville Library where she lives and works whenever you need it, “Celestia explained, “She’s also been kind enough to take the liberty of booking you all rooms at the local inn.”
“Sounds good. Thank you very much Princesses.” Hotch gave the royal alicorns a low respectful bow, “Alright team, get yourselves ready. I expect you all ready to go in an hour. We’re heading to Ponyville.”

The team assembled and was settling in for the journey when Hotch called their attentions to the case, “we need to start building a preliminary profile. With this many missing, I want to hit the ground running after this unsub.”
“Well he doesn’t seem to have a particular type,” Rossi offered, “Fillies, colts, mares and stallions. No accounting for age or gender.”
“So he’s diverse. Now here’s the big question,” Prentiss began, “What’s he doing with them?”
“No bodies have been found. And no evidence to suggest that any of the missing are dead.” Hotch said thoughtfully. Though his expression remained that of the usual blank, his team knew that there was a part of him holding onto the desperate hope that these ponies may still be alive and safe.
Though he hated to have to burst that hopeful bubble Reid spoke up solemnly, “but with this number of victims I think we can safely assume that everypony that’s missing is dead. If he were keeping them all alive there’d have been a sign of somepony by now. The number of missing is too extensive to assume they are alive. And even if we were to be idealistic about it, the profiles of a kidnapper and murderer are different.”
This statement was followed by tensed silence, broken only when Hotch sighed, “Reid’s right. So we look at this as serial killings rather than abductions. JJ” he turned to acknowledge the pretty butter yellow mare to his left, “you and I will go meet up with this Twilight Sparkle and get ourselves set up. Morgan and Prentiss,” turned now t the dark brown stallion and the charcoal gray mare, “Canvas the neighbourhoods, and talk to any of the most recent victim’s friends. See if anypony knows where she was heading when she disappeared. Rossi and Reid,” turned finally to the elder stallion with the greying salt and pepper mane, and the gawky youth, “Go to Rainbow Dash’s house, see if there is anything useful.”
Each member of the team nodded their understanding, and silences descended upon the BAU as each pony lost themselves in thoughts of the new horrors of pony kind they were sure to uncover in this case.
